CBT Training Overview
The CBT training program is designed to provide participants with foundational knowledge and skills in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T) over a span of approximately 2 hours per week. The structure of the training includes both general CBT concepts and specific applications relevant to various mental health presentations.
Training Structure
Duration: Approximately 2 hours per week (with pre-recorded sessions available)
Format:
Pre-recorded sessions: Each week, you will receive a recorded session that you can watch at your convenience. This gives you the flexibility to review the content at your own pace.
Focused CBT training on specific presentations, including:
Social Anxiety
Panic Disorders
Depression
Self-Esteem Issues
Adapting CBT for Children
Resources: Signposting to relevant resources will be provided throughout the course.
Q&A Video: After reviewing the weekly content, participants will have the opportunity to submit questions. I will then respond with a recorded video answering those questions. This ensures you have access to all the support you need, just as you would in a live session.
